Is it for real or it is just a rumor? The Chief Executive Officer of the huge company Intel Germany stated that they will be working with Apple soon and do an Iphone project together. They will be doing a future Iphone whose version is based from the Intel’ processor called Atom. The future Iphone project is said to be a bigger model having larger display just like mini-tablet device. The same device has been rumored to be under the development of Apple as well. Hannes Schwaderer also stated that the upgraded Iphone version will also become a 3G model.

But just a few hours later, Hannes Schwaderer retracted what he stated about the Atom-powered Iphone. He said that the statement was just a misunderstanding. The article regarding the issue posted in ZDNet was written in German language. Hannes Schwaderer claimed that it was poorly translated in English which resulted




to the misconception.

According to Mike Cato, the spokesman for Intel Germany, their company does not know anything about the future projects or products of the manufacturers that are not related or even related to them. Therefore, they also do not have the right to say anything as well.

What’s more interesting about this story is that some people who attended the attendedthe event said that they did not heard the CEO of Intel Germany saying such things about the future collaboration between their company and Apple working together to create a new version of Iphone. On the other hand, there are others who claimed that they did hear it. It really is quite a messy rumor. The only way to know if this rumor is true or not is by attending the WWDC event of Apple, where people also suspected that the company will launch its new 3G Iphone.
